Remote privilege escalation via output-position bounds check
Published Nov 20, 2024 · Updated Nov 20, 2024
Out-of-bounds write in Android 7.0 through 9 allows remote attackers to gain privileges in an unprivileged app with user interaction. The bbf_Scanner_addOutPos function in external/neven's Scanner.c uses an incorrect bounds check before adding an output position, permitting a write beyond the destination bounds. Exploitation requires user interaction; successful exploitation elevates code running in an otherwise unprivileged application context.
